          you've forgotten to mention a wireless card (now are available N compatible standard chipsets) with a ralink or atheros chipset included. they work very well with linux (a complete chipset list are available at the madwifi site - atheros, or at the ralink site - http://www.ralinktech.com/ralink/Hom...ort/Linux.html )
          also i'd go up with the ram to at least 4gb (now the ram doesn't cost much). and i'd say that the best buy for hard drives in terms of cost per megabyte is with 500gb hd. a medium range raid controller might increase well the office stability (i'd suggest not to use the integrated low cost raid controllers).
          as for data protection i'd suggest you to start from the following example as a partitioning scheme:

          / on primary reiser3 fs without tail, with r5 hash and 3.6 revision filesystem and with noatime mount option (usually is enough a 5gb root filesystem)
          /boot on a 100megabyte partition with the same partitioning as the root, with the same mount options but without mounting it at boot
          /var /usr /opt /home each on a lvm2 container with /home and /opt ciphered with dm. this would ensure the following:
          1. resize volume if needed
          2. security for personal data and non free software (which usually goes in /opt).

          almost any linux distro is able to handle this configuration without any problems.

          as for distros i'd advice you to chose among the following:
          - kubuntu/ubuntu and opensuse
          - novell linux enterprise desktop/red hat enterprise desktop

          the first list would be for user that don't want a hardened system, but still very stable, simple and intuitive to use, while the second group is very good for enterprises.

          as for the x-window environments i'd suggest kde for 2 reasons:
          1. a very high presence of high quality applications integrated with kde
          2. kde 3.5.9 has reached a very high quality level
          3. i've found out kdevelop to be a very good developing suite
          4. familiarity for windows users (it is more similar to windows desktops with respect of gnome)

          of course this changes if the customer focuses on mono/.net developing, in which case gnome is more indicated. also if this is the case i'd also suggest opting for a novell release.

          of course i'd advise you to make the choice after the 24th of april when hardy heron would be out (it should be a long term supported kubuntu/ubuntu). i'd try out both versions (don't use kde4 for now since it's not ready for enterprise use, but only for personal use) and decide for the one that fits more the company views.

            When it comes to video cards, intel cards are very well supported, but when it comes to resolutions up to 1920 x 1200, they just won't do. So what are my options?

            I recon that ATI cards will be very well supported in the future, but we need this in place before june. Nvidia have always been 'OK', but are lagging behind. Any ideas?

              Nvidia is not really lagging behind. For current chips ATI offers no real 3d accelleration in free and basically every OSS driver misses features that would allow to run current games. Also ATI has absolutely no Crossfire support, but Nvidia has SLI and MultiGPU support in the drivers for years. Until you want to show of a very lowend graphics solution then Nvidia is the way to go. Midrange 9600 GT, better 8800 GTS 512 or 9800 GTX.
